  1. // SPDX-License-Identifier: GPL-2.0-only
  2. /*
  3. * QLogic FCoE Offload Driver
  4. * Copyright (c) 2016-2018 Cavium Inc.
  5. */
  6. #include "qedf_dbg.h"
  7. #include <linux/vmalloc.h>
  8. void
  9. qedf_dbg_err(struct qedf_dbg_ctx *qedf, const char *func, u32 line,
  10. const char *fmt, ...)
  11. {
  12. va_list va;
  13. struct va_format vaf;
  14. va_start(va, fmt);
  15. vaf.fmt = fmt;
  16. vaf.va = &va;
  17. if (likely(qedf) && likely(qedf->pdev))
  18. pr_err("[%s]:[%s:%d]:%d: %pV", dev_name(&(qedf->pdev->dev)),
  19. func, line, qedf->host_no, &vaf);
  20. else
  21. pr_err("[0000:00:00.0]:[%s:%d]: %pV", func, line, &vaf);
  22. va_end(va);
  23. }
  24. void
  25. qedf_dbg_warn(struct qedf_dbg_ctx *qedf, const char *func, u32 line,
  26. const char *fmt, ...)
  27. {
  28. va_list va;
  29. struct va_format vaf;
  30. va_start(va, fmt);
  31. vaf.fmt = fmt;
  32. vaf.va = &va;
  33. if (!(qedf_debug & QEDF_LOG_WARN))
  34. goto ret;
  35. if (likely(qedf) && likely(qedf->pdev))
  36. pr_warn("[%s]:[%s:%d]:%d: %pV", dev_name(&(qedf->pdev->dev)),
  37. func, line, qedf->host_no, &vaf);
  38. else
  39. pr_warn("[0000:00:00.0]:[%s:%d]: %pV", func, line, &vaf);
  40. ret:
  41. va_end(va);
  42. }
  43. void
  44. qedf_dbg_notice(struct qedf_dbg_ctx *qedf, const char *func, u32 line,
  45. const char *fmt, ...)
  46. {
  47. va_list va;
  48. struct va_format vaf;
  49. va_start(va, fmt);
  50. vaf.fmt = fmt;
  51. vaf.va = &va;
  52. if (!(qedf_debug & QEDF_LOG_NOTICE))
  53. goto ret;
  54. if (likely(qedf) && likely(qedf->pdev))
  55. pr_notice("[%s]:[%s:%d]:%d: %pV",
  56. dev_name(&(qedf->pdev->dev)), func, line,
  57. qedf->host_no, &vaf);
  58. else
  59. pr_notice("[0000:00:00.0]:[%s:%d]: %pV", func, line, &vaf);
  60. ret:
  61. va_end(va);
  62. }
  63. void
  64. qedf_dbg_info(struct qedf_dbg_ctx *qedf, const char *func, u32 line,
  65. u32 level, const char *fmt, ...)
  66. {
  67. va_list va;
  68. struct va_format vaf;
  69. va_start(va, fmt);
  70. vaf.fmt = fmt;
  71. vaf.va = &va;
  72. if (!(qedf_debug & level))
  73. goto ret;
  74. if (likely(qedf) && likely(qedf->pdev))
  75. pr_info("[%s]:[%s:%d]:%d: %pV", dev_name(&(qedf->pdev->dev)),
  76. func, line, qedf->host_no, &vaf);
  77. else
  78. pr_info("[0000:00:00.0]:[%s:%d]: %pV", func, line, &vaf);
  79. ret:
  80. va_end(va);
  81. }
  82. int
  83. qedf_alloc_grc_dump_buf(u8 **buf, uint32_t len)
  84. {
  85. *buf = vzalloc(len);
  86. if (!(*buf))
  87. return -ENOMEM;
  88. return 0;
  89. }
  90. void
  91. qedf_free_grc_dump_buf(uint8_t **buf)
  92. {
  93. vfree(*buf);
  94. *buf = NULL;
  95. }
  96. int
  97. qedf_get_grc_dump(struct qed_dev *cdev, const struct qed_common_ops *common,
  98. u8 **buf, uint32_t *grcsize)
  99. {
  100. if (!*buf)
  101. return -EINVAL;
  102. return common->dbg_all_data(cdev, *buf);
  103. }
  104. void
  105. qedf_uevent_emit(struct Scsi_Host *shost, u32 code, char *msg)
  106. {
  107. char event_string[40];
  108. char *envp[] = {event_string, NULL};
  109. memset(event_string, 0, sizeof(event_string));
  110. switch (code) {
  111. case QEDF_UEVENT_CODE_GRCDUMP:
  112. if (msg)
  113. strscpy(event_string, msg, sizeof(event_string));
  114. else
  115. sprintf(event_string, "GRCDUMP=%u", shost->host_no);
  116. break;
  117. default:
  118. /* do nothing */
  119. break;
  120. }
  121. kobject_uevent_env(&shost->shost_gendev.kobj, KOBJ_CHANGE, envp);
  122. }
  123. int
  124. qedf_create_sysfs_attr(struct Scsi_Host *shost, struct sysfs_bin_attrs *iter)
  125. {
  126. int ret = 0;
  127. for (; iter->name; iter++) {
  128. ret = sysfs_create_bin_file(&shost->shost_gendev.kobj,
  129. iter->attr);
  130. if (ret)
  131. pr_err("Unable to create sysfs %s attr, err(%d).\n",
  132. iter->name, ret);
  133. }
  134. return ret;
  135. }
  136. void
  137. qedf_remove_sysfs_attr(struct Scsi_Host *shost, struct sysfs_bin_attrs *iter)
  138. {
  139. for (; iter->name; iter++)
  140. sysfs_remove_bin_file(&shost->shost_gendev.kobj, iter->attr);
